Are Nudes Illegal? The Ultimate Guide to Nude Photo Laws

Navigating the legal status of intimate digital content requires more than a simple yes or no answer. The question of are nudes illegal touches on privacy, consent, and technology in ways that surprise many people. What one person considers a harmless private photo can become a serious legal issue under the wrong circumstances. This complexity exists because laws vary by location and the specific context of the image sharing.

At the core of this issue is the concept of consent. Taking a nude photograph for personal use is generally legal in most jurisdictions. The legal trouble begins when that image is shared without permission. Sending a picture to a partner typically falls within personal sharing agreements. However, distributing nudes to third parties or posting them online without authorization crosses into illegal territory in many places.

The Role of Revenge Porn Laws

Many regions have enacted specific laws targeting non-consensual pornography. These statutes make it a crime to share intimate images with the intent to cause harm, embarrassment, or extortion. The protected status of the image is irrelevant if the distribution violates the subject's privacy. Penalties for these offenses can include heavy fines and imprisonment, reflecting the serious nature of the violation.

Another critical layer involves the age of the subjects in the photographs. Creating or possessing nude images of minors is illegal in virtually every country, classified as child pornography. This applies even when the minor takes the picture of themselves. Sexting between teenagers presents a gray area where legal prosecution sometimes occurs, though many jurisdictions have diversion programs to address youth behavior without criminal records.

Jurisdictional Variations in Law

The answer to are nudes illegal changes depending on where you live. European countries often have strong privacy protections that treat non-consensual image sharing as a severe violation. In the United States, states like California have specific "revenge porn" laws, while other states rely on existing harassment or privacy statutes. International travelers should research local laws, as what is permissible in one country can result in immediate arrest in another.

Platform Policies and Digital Footprints

Beyond criminal law, community standards dictate the legality of content on social media and messaging apps. Platforms like Instagram and WhatsApp actively remove nude content and ban accounts that violate these rules. Even if sharing nudes is not explicitly criminal in your region, violating a service agreement can result in account suspension or legal action from the platform itself.

The permanence of digital data means that once a nude image escapes private control, it can circulate forever. Screenshots can be taken, and copies can exist on unknown servers. This reality transforms a private moment into a potential legal liability that affects future employment, relationships, and reputation. Understanding these risks is essential for anyone engaging in intimate digital communication.
